About This Manual
This Operating Manual contains operation instructions for the
XT
Series of high
performance, switching, laboratory power supplies, available in several voltage
models at 60 watts. It provides information on features and specifications,
installation procedures, and basic functions testing, as well as operating procedures
for using both standard and multiple supply functions.
Who Should Use This Manual
This manual is designed for the user who is familiar with basic electrical laws,
especially as they apply to the operation of power supplies. This implies a
recognition of Constant Voltage and Constant Current operating modes and the
control of input and output power, as well as the observance of safe techniques while
calibrating, making supply connections and/or any changes in configuration.
